Molyneux: Fable franchise could die if it doesn’t grow

March 12, 2010

Molyneux: Fable franchise could die if it doesn’t growDuring GDC, Peter Molyneux gave a very nice power point presentation of the goals behind the ambitious Fable III. He may have provided too much information when he stated that the Fable franchise will die if it does not grow.

Molyneux’s slide he believes that approximately 60 percent of Fable’s audience understood 50 percent of the features in the Fable games. I find that statement odd as I criticized the game for being to dumbed down during my review of Fable II previously.

He also indicated that to rectify this issue Lionhead studios will be converting Fable III into an action-adventure title, as this genre sells better than the RPG genre. This is a surprising move as the Fable series has strong RPG roots.

Molyneux also talked about the sales history of the Fable franchise. The first Fable game sold approximately 3 million units and Fable II sold 3.5 million units. He stated that the studio has been “very happy” with its sales but if the Fable franchise were to survive, Fable III must sell 5 million units. He alluded to the fact that the Fable franchise could die if it does not grow.

It’s an odd thing to reveal to the public as it puts the onus on the consumer to prevent this from happening. It will be interesting to see how Molyneux plans to change Fable III so that it appeals to a wider audience.
